Shedeur Sanders is not the backup quarterback for the Cleveland Browns, and fans have been expressing mixed reactions. Instead of Sanders, rookie Dillon Gabriel will be QB2 to veteran Joe Flacco, who will be the starting quarterback for the team in the 2025 NFL season. Many have been voicing their disappointment with head coach Kevin Stefanski’s decision, while others, like former Philadelphia Eagles center Jason Kelce, side with him.

Jason Kelce and his brother, Travis Kelce, were discussing exactly this in the latest episode of their ‘New Heights’ podcast. While Jason Kelce felt that head coach Stefanski’s decision was valid, Travis Kelce had another opinion.

“This isn’t anything against Dillon; this isn’t anything against Joe. I’m just saying the excitement is there for him to go out there. He’s going to put eyes on the screen. He’s going to bring people to the game. It is what it is. I would love to f**king see it, man. I would love to f**king see it.” Travis Kelce said about Shedeur Sanders in the latest episode of the ‘New Heights’ podcast.

Travis Kelce’s words about Shedeur Sanders are actually right since Deion Sanders’ youngest son has easily become the most popular player in the Cleveland Browns ever since his arrival. Shedeur Sanders has also managed to impress in the preseason games, stunning in the opener with two touchdowns.

However, he was unable to do much in the preseason finale since head coach Kevin Stefanski pulled him out prematurely. For this move, Stefanski has been called out and condemned by many who feel that the head coach should have done differently.

Shedeur Sanders’ Browns Called Out By Cam Newton

Meanwhile, Shedeur Sanders has built up quite an army of supporters around him. Retired NFL quarterback Cam Newton recently expressed that the Cleveland Browns have done a shoddy job at giving players their deserved opportunities.

“It’s getting to a point where it’s becoming abundantly clear that there is a motive in Cleveland. Now, when I look at the stat line, some people would look at yards, some would look at TDs. What I’m seeing is the efficiency, more or less, the sack yards.” Cam Newton said about Shedeur Sanders and the Cleveland Browns.

Cam Newton remarked that he would like to see “equality amongst the locker room in Cleveland”, which pretty much echoes what many NFL fans are thinking at the moment. No matter what happens, Shedeur Sanders continues to be one of the most popular players in the Browns camp right now.
